Aspects Influencing Cat Flap Installation Costs


Before diving into the price list, it's essential to understand the elements that can impact installation costs:

  1. Type of Cat Flap: Various styles, materials, and performances affect the cost. Standard manual flaps are generally cheaper, while electronic or microchip-activated alternatives tend to be more expensive.

  2. Door or Wall Material: The type of material your door or wall is made from (wood, glass, brick, and so on) will impact installation complexity and expenses. More complicated products typically need customized tools and extra labor.

  3. Place: Depending on where you live, installation expenses can differ significantly. Urban areas might have higher labor rates compared to rural areas.

  4. Installation Service: Some installers offer detailed services, including elimination of existing flaps and extra repair work, which can increase the price.

  5. Experience Level: Established experts with a strong track record might charge more due to their expertise.

Typical Cost Breakdown


To provide you a clearer photo, we have actually compiled an average price list classifications based on normal installation situations. The following table sums up typical installation fees in different situations.

Kind Of Cat Flap

Typical Price (Materials Only)

Average Installation Cost

Total Cost

Standard Manual Cat Flap

₤ 20 – ₤ 50

₤ 50 – ₤ 80

₤ 70 – ₤ 130

High-Security Manual Cat Flap

₤ 40 – ₤ 80

₤ 50 – ₤ 100

₤ 90 – ₤ 180

Microchip or Electronic Cat Flap

₤ 80 – ₤ 150

₤ 70 – ₤ 120

₤ 150 – ₤ 270

Glass Door Cat Flap

₤ 100 – ₤ 200

₤ 150 – ₤ 300

₤ 250 – ₤ 500

Wall Installation

₤ 50 – ₤ 120

₤ 100 – ₤ 200

₤ 150 – ₤ 320

Types of Cat Flaps


When choosing which type of cat flap is suitable for your home, it's important to think about performance and safety. Here's a list of common cat flap types:

  1. Standard Manual Cat Flap: Simple and affordable, these allow your cat to go into and exit freely.

  2. High-Security Cat Flap: These use extra security features, such as locking systems, to keep undesirable animals out.

  3. Microchip Cat Flap: These need your pet to have a microchip to go into, preventing outdoors animals from using the flap.

  4. Electronic Cat Flap: These are battery-operated and frequently come with a timer or can be set to permit access at specific times.

  5. Glass Door Cat Flap: These are installed in glass doors and need professional installation due to the requirement to modify the glass panel.

FAQs about Cat Flap Installation


1. Can I install a cat flap myself?

While it is possible to set up a cat flap yourself, it needs certain tools and abilities, specifically if dealing with a glass door or wall installation. For the most safe and most enticing result, employing a professional is recommended.

2. Exist any extra expenses I should understand?

Depending on the installer, certain extra expenses may use, such as disposal costs for old flaps or repair work needed throughout installation. Make sure to ask about any possible concealed expenses in advance.

3. For how long does the installation procedure take?

4. What if I wish to eliminate my cat flap later on?

Many installers can remove existing cat flaps, however this may include an additional fee. It's a good idea to ask about potential costs connected with elimination when getting quotes.

5. Can any door or wall accommodate a cat flap?

The majority of door types can accommodate a cat flap, however walls might require custom-made work. Guarantee you seek advice from with your installer regarding your specific installation circumstance.
